Spencer P Tuttle, Age 40

Willard, OH

Known As:

  • Spencer Katie Tuttle
Phones
(419) 935-8767
Addresses
927 Tamarack Dr, Willard, OH 44890 and 1 more

Phones and Addresses

Available data on Spencer T.
Available data on Spencer T.

FAQ about Spencer P Tuttle

  • What is Spencer P Tuttle’s phone number?

    Spencer P Tuttle’s phone number is (419) 935-8767.

  • What is Spencer P Tuttle’s date of birth?

    Spencer P Tuttle was born on 1984.